package transcriber import ( "bytes" "context" "encoding/json" "fmt" "io" "log" "mime/multipart" "net/http" "time" ) // ElevenLabsAdapter implements TranscriptionAdapter for ElevenLabs Scribe API type ElevenLabsAdapter struct { client *http.Client config Config } // ElevenLabsResponse represents the API response type ElevenLabsResponse struct { Text string `json:"text"` } // NewElevenLabsAdapter creates a new ElevenLabs adapter func NewElevenLabsAdapter(config Config) *ElevenLabsAdapter { return &ElevenLabsAdapter{ client: &http.Client{Timeout: 30 * time.Second}, config: config, } } // Transcribe sends audio to ElevenLabs API for transcription func (a *ElevenLabsAdapter) Transcribe(ctx context.Context, audioData []byte) (string, error) { if len(audioData) == 0 { return "", nil } // Convert raw PCM to WAV format wavData, err := convertToWAV(audioData) if err != nil { return "", fmt.Errorf("convert to WAV: %w", err) } // Create multipart form body var body bytes.Buffer writer := multipart.NewWriter(&body) // Add audio file part, err := writer.CreateFormFile("file", "audio.wav") if err != nil { return "", fmt.Errorf("create form file: %w", err) } if _, err := io.Copy(part, bytes.NewReader(wavData)); err != nil { return "", fmt.Errorf("copy audio data: %w", err) } // Add model_id if err := writer.WriteField("model_id", a.config.Model); err != nil { return "", fmt.Errorf("write model_id: %w", err) } // Add language_code if specified if a.config.Language != "" { if err := writer.WriteField("language_code", a.config.Language); err != nil { return "", fmt.Errorf("write language_code: %w", err) } } if err := writer.Close(); err != nil { return "", fmt.Errorf("close writer: %w", err) } // Create HTTP request url := "https://api.elevenlabs.io/v1/speech-to-text" req, err := http.NewRequestWithContext(ctx, "POST", url, &body) if err != nil { return "", fmt.Errorf("create request: %w", err) } req.Header.Set("Content-Type", writer.FormDataContentType()) req.Header.Set("xi-api-key", a.config.APIKey) start := time.Now() resp, err := a.client.Do(req) duration := time.Since(start) if err != nil { log.Printf("elevenlabs-adapter: API call failed after %v: %v", duration, err) return "", fmt.Errorf("elevenlabs request: %w", err) } defer resp.Body.Close() if resp.StatusCode != http.StatusOK { bodyBytes, _ := io.ReadAll(resp.Body) log.Printf("elevenlabs-adapter: API returned status %d: %s", resp.StatusCode, string(bodyBytes)) return "", fmt.Errorf("elevenlabs API status %d: %s", resp.StatusCode, string(bodyBytes)) } var result ElevenLabsResponse if err := json.NewDecoder(resp.Body).Decode(&result); err != nil { return "", fmt.Errorf("decode response: %w", err) } log.Printf("elevenlabs-adapter: transcribed %d bytes in %v: %q", len(audioData), duration, result.Text) return result.Text, nil }
